Make a transponder car key

You can find locksmiths near you when you're looking to replace the transponder keys in your car. This type of key is more secure than standard keys made of metal, and is designed to prevent auto theft.

These keys have an embedded chip in their heads. The chip is an individual code. When the key is put into the ignition, the computer of the vehicle scans for the code. If the computer recognizes the code, the ignition will turn off.

Transponder keys for cars are a little more complex than regular keys due to the fact that they must be programmed into the car's onboard computer. Most locksmiths can do this for you however, you could also buy a key online.

Although car dealerships can be an excellent source of transponder keys, they can also be expensive. A key can be purchased from dealers for hundreds of dollars. However, you'll usually find them at AutoZone for much less money.

In addition to making copies of the keys, a locksmith can also program your transponder car keys. Programming is required for many automobiles.

Replace a dead key fob

The key fob can be an important component of your car. It acts as a remote control and allows you to open and shut your doors. There are a myriad of options for you to replace your key fob. You can bring your keys to the dealer to be programmed. This can be costly.

You could also contact a locksmith for assistance. These experts are well-trained to work with electronics. They can re-program your keys, or get rid of old batteries. They'll charge a cost however they can be extremely useful.

If you have lost the keys to your car, you need to report the loss to the police. Insurance companies might provide a replacement key, but you will require a copy of the police report.

If you do not have a spare, you can buy a key fob battery from the local locksmiths for cars store. You can also purchase one online. Or, you can have locksmiths replace your keys for you.

A key fob is normally made of a small CR2032 battery. Typically, it is priced at about $10. Autozone also offers replacement keys for cars. There are over 6000 locations.

If your key fob isn't working, it is worth taking a look at the battery. The battery replacement is a simple task. However, it won't solve the problem.

The complexity of your car could mean that your key needs to be programmed again. This can be done by an automotive or dealer locksmith.

Programming your key fob yourself can be a frustrating exercise. You may want to consider hiring an expert to program your key fob if don't have any knowledge about car electronic systems.

Replace a smart key

A mobile locksmith car is required if you own a car and you need to replace a smart-key. Locksmiths are adept at handling this kind of job. They can reprogram your keys, program them, and cut your new keys.

The costs of replacing a smart-key can differ widely, based on the year of the vehicle and whether or if you need to order a replacement key from the dealer. If you have a newer model the price could range anywhere from $200 to $500.

Smart keys can be utilized on a variety of vehicles, even those with keyless entry systems. These keys allow you to unlock and open the doors without needing to enter the car. You can hold your keys in the palm of your hand, or keep it in your pocket or purse.

A local auto dealer is able to replace your smart key, but it may take a while. It could take several days for the dealer to match your new key to your vehicle.

Remember that you'll require proof of ownership to the dealer. Additionally, you'll need to have your vehicle towed by the dealer.

Certain vehicles come with an immobilizer feature, which prevents your car from starting if don't have the key. The emergency blade is an additional layer of protection against theft. It can open the door on the driver's side in the situation of an emergency.
